I guess the converts have some different springs in the rear, so the car won't twist as much, these spring can cause more wheel hop, the drag tires help with wheel hop.

This is what I was told, not 100% sure if it's true. Bottomline I have a full inspection WITH a leakdown test schedule before the actual sale.

If everything checks out I'm then going to get 3M's PPF professionaly installed on the front end to protect it from rock chips for the 1600 mile trip back.
